Transaction 0ddfba51e709057b9b70148fad19bdb71a3e84a1bd89dbbbba835a598dab8212
1 Input
1 Output
-
0ddfba51e709057b9b70148fad19bdb71a3e84a1bd89dbbbba835a598dab8212:0
- value
- 251696
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03ce2cdd66e8ae22099a153a2489383f33f920e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M81tEC93GkVJY22Fj3ZmRWAy2WQavu8R